Kehinde Wiley's Life and Work
Kehinde was born in Los Angeles, CA of 1977. He is a New York based portrait painter. His mom enrolled him in an art school in Russia at the age of 12. He recieved his BFA from the Art Institute of San Francisco in 1999 and earned his MFA two years later from Yale University. Wiley uses photographs of young men he sees on the streets and bases his portraits off them.
